Good start!

what kind of exhaust is that?

18x8.5 you have to go somewhere near the low 20s or high 10s if you want to go flush, and depending on if you want that meaty fitment or the other look.
dont need spacers if you get your offsets right the first time!
unless they don't make those particular offsets.

and of course you cant go flush without some lowering springs or the preferred coilovers
